Canstruction San Diego 2007

Canstruction is an international charity of the design and construction industry created by the Society for Design Administration. Architects and Engineers in cities across the country compete in a design-build competition to create giant works of sculptural art, made entirely out of canned and packaged foods. Canstruction provides the opportunity for the design industry to become involved in a pressing social issue, while their creativity involves them in a national competition that brings recognition, offers team bonding opportunities, and instills a sense of pride knowing “one can” really make a difference.
